Neither has he been afraid of allowing his stories to point a moral. Art for art's sake is all very well, but it does not detract from the artistic quality of a work of fiction that it should inculcate an ethical lesson. Charles Reade, Dickens, Thackery — and how many others — have fought some abuse of public administration, or, with the weapons of irony and invective, attacked some darling vice, some pet dereliction of our faulty, stumbling human nature. And it is because they get right down to human nature that these masters, and such as they, are able to move us.
